## ChattyTap 1.4.0 — Key rotation

Scope: log sampling sidecar for the Murmur service. Rotated the artifact signing key per quarterly policy. Old key is revoked; any sampling-config bundles signed before this release will fail verification on deploy. If you're onboarding: pull latest, re-run the bundle signer, redeploy. Sampling rates, filters, and the drop-list format are unchanged. Questions go to the platform channel. For verification during your local setup, the new signing key is below.

release key, fajef-kajeg: bky19_LdLu6Ne6FLi8he2c24d

**Q: How do we run schema migrations without downtime?**

All Quillbase migrations follow the expand-and-contract pattern: add the new column or table first, dual-write from the application, backfill in batches, then drop the old structure in a later release. Never combine an expand and a contract step in one deploy. Migrations run through the Ledgewick pipeline, which enforces a dry run against a replica. The step-by-step checklist and approval workflow are documented on the page below.

dashboard of faweg-kaguf = https://confluence.norvaworks.corp/display/spaces/browse/c358524c20b3

Subject: Pricing update — Bramwick line

Team,

Effective next quarter, list prices across the Bramwick product line will rise by an average of 6%. Branch managers should apply the new rate card to all new quotes; existing quotes remain valid for thirty days. Discount authority thresholds are unchanged. Please brief your sales leads before the announcement. The strategic context is set out in the note below.

confidential, kagep-kahof: Druokax Systems plans to lower the Ulaath list price by 53 percent in March.